Title/Escrow Services Sample Clauses

Title/Escrow Services. Consultant will work with a local Title Company to provide title and escrow services for up to 11 parcels. Consultant’s Title Company will have a local office for the ease of coordination with property owners and County ROW staff. County will acquire preliminary title reports for all properties from Placer Title Company and will provide to Consultant. Consultant shall insure that all closings are accomplished in a timely manner through continued coordination with the Title Company handling the escrows. Consultant shall work closely with the chosen Title Company to ensure that marketable title is obtained for the County. These services include: • Reviewing Preliminary Title Reports to determine current exceptions, open Deeds of Trust, and legal ownership. • Notify County ROW Agent if there are any potential Title issues and coordinate with Title Company to clear issues. • Open escrow, deposit funds and documents, prepare escrow instructions, and monitor closing of escrows. • Assist Title Company in obtaining partial releases of liens, mortgages, and encumbrances of record. • Prepare warrant requests to County with proper supporting documentation including recommended resolution of title issues. • Verify and coordinate the clearing or prorating of taxes and assessments. • Coordinate closings and attend all meetings. • Review the final Title Policy to make sure it reflects only those title exceptions that County had agreed to accept.
